Inhibidores

Inhibidores

Los inhibidores son moléculas que se unen a enzimas, receptores u otras proteínas para reducir o bloquear su actividad biológica. Estos compuestos se utilizan ampliamente en la investigación para estudiar vías biológicas, comprender los mecanismos de las enfermedades y desarrollar fármacos terapéuticos. Los inhibidores desempeñan un papel crucial en el tratamiento de diversas enfermedades, incluyendo el cáncer, las enfermedades cardiovasculares y las infecciones.
